A 23-year-old Woodstock man was found dead Saturday night on West Station Drive in Cobb County, police said.

Justin C. Dallas of Woodstock had been shot to death about 9:50 p.m., Cobb County police spokeswoman Officer Alicia Chilton said.

Neighbors in the Bells Ferry Station neighborhood reported hearing shots shortly before police arrived and found Dallas dead.

Naeem Jakwan Edwards, 19, of Acworth, was arrested in connection to Dallas’ death, Chilton said. Edwards faces felony murder and aggravated assault with intent to murder charges.

The shooting is the second in two days reported in Cobb County.

Two 21-year-old men were wounded early Friday, The Atlanta Journal-Constitution previously reported.

Police responded to a call about gunshots exchanged between two groups at a large party in Kennesaw about 1 a.m., Chilton said.

That shooting was at the Stadium Village Apartments in the 3000 block of Hidden Forest Court, which is about 3 miles from the location of Saturday night’s shooting.
